Subject: [PATCH 1/4] rpc.gssd: simplify signal handling

We're not actually using the extra sa_sigaction parameters.
Signed-off-by: J. Bruce Fields <bfields@redhat.com>
---
utils/gssd/gssd_main_loop.c | 11 +++++------
1 file changed, 5 insertions(+), 6 deletions(-)
diff --git a/utils/gssd/gssd_main_loop.c b/utils/gssd/gssd_main_loop.c
index c18e12c..9954ffb 100644
--- a/utils/gssd/gssd_main_loop.c
+++ b/utils/gssd/gssd_main_loop.c
@@ -61,9 +61,9 @@ extern int pollsize;
static volatile int dir_changed = 1;
-static void dir_notify_handler(int sig, siginfo_t *si, void *data)
+static void dir_notify_handler(int sig)
{
- printerr(2, "dir_notify_handler: sig %d si %p data %p\n", sig, si, data);
+ printerr(2, "dir_notify_handler: sig %d\n", sig);
dir_changed = 1;
}
@@ -183,13 +183,12 @@ void
gssd_run()
{
int ret;
- struct sigaction dn_act;
+ struct sigaction dn_act = {
+ .sa_handler = dir_notify_handler
+ };
sigset_t set;
- /* Taken from linux/Documentation/dnotify.txt: */
- dn_act.sa_sigaction = dir_notify_handler;
sigemptyset(&dn_act.sa_mask);
- dn_act.sa_flags = SA_SIGINFO;
sigaction(DNOTIFY_SIGNAL, &dn_act, NULL);
/* just in case the signal is blocked... */
